Career Path
The Certificate Programme in Water Equity Advocacy Monitoring is a valuable investment for those interested in water equity and environmental careers.
In the UK, job market trends show that water-related professions are in demand.
Let's explore the top five roles in this field, their responsibilities, and salary ranges. 1. Water Engineer: Design, construct, and maintain water and wastewater treatment facilities. *Salary range*: Β£25,000 to Β£50,000 2. Water Quality Specialist: Monitor, assess, and report water quality parameters. *Salary range*: Β£22,000 to Β£40,000 3. Hydrologist: Study the distribution, circulation, and properties of water in the environment. *Salary range*: Β£20,000 to Β£45,000 4. Water Resource Manager: Oversee the allocation and management of water resources. *Salary range*: Β£25,000 to Β£55,000 5. Environmental Consultant: Provide advice and guidance on environmental issues, including water management. *Salary range*: Β£20,000 to Β£60,000 These roles require a strong foundation in water-related skills, which this certificate programme offers.
